Lisbon’s transport network brings together several layers: metro, historic trams and a bus system. In this video, we explore how these modes interact in different parts of the city. The journey starts on the metro, where multiple generations of trains — ML90, ML95 and ML99 — operate together, often in mixed consists. Key interchanges such as Alameda and the deep Baixa-Chiado station show how the network is structured despite its compact size. At street level, the contrast becomes clear: small historic trams on route 28E handle tight curves and steep streets, while modern CAF Urbos trams on line 15E serve higher-capacity routes.
